Send
Go to Send Identication (see 6.21, p. 137), avoiding the detour around the normal op-
tions menu hierarchy. The current identiication will be already chosen for sending.
Logarithmic Linear Square Root Ymax/2 Ymax/4
Cycle the methods for the vertical scaling. The current method is indicated in the status bar
right of the chart (Figure 112, p. 109). The method you get after pressing the key is shown in
the key description.
For logarithmic, linear, and square root scaling the maximum peak is rendered so it makes
best use of the available screen height.
The other scalings stretch the rendering so that only the given bottom fraction of the spectrum
is visible. Higher peaks are cut off.
Energy Channel
Cycle the options for the display of horizontal coordinates in the spectrum. The current unit
and range is shown above the chart (Figure 112, p. 109 and Figure 110, p. 107). The variant
you get after pressing the key is shown in the key description.
Calibration
View a detail spectrum to check the calibration. Please refer to 6.3, p. 115 for details.
LT RT
Specify the type of display for the duration of data acquisition.
You can specify real or live time display. The current setting is shown below the chart (Fig-
ure 110, p. 107).
No matter what you specify here, the dead time (DT) is always shown as a percentage of the
real time.
